Como 1907, affectionately known as the Lariani, is a historic Italian football club that represents the city of Como in Lombardy. Founded in 1907, the team has experienced a rollercoaster journey through Italian football, participating in various tiers of the national league system over its more than century-long existence.

Notable History

The club’s golden era came in the 1950s when Como achieved promotion to Serie A, Italy’s top flight, and managed to stay there for several seasons. Durante Varisco, one of the club’s most celebrated figures, played a crucial role during this period, becoming an icon for the azzurri-blu faithful. The team has since oscillated between Serie A, B, and C, with their most recent Serie A appearance coming in the 2002-03 season.

Stadium and Colors

The Stadio Giuseppe Sinigaglia, situated on the shores of the picturesque Lake Como, has been the team’s home since 1927. With a capacity of approximately 13,000, it provides an intimate atmosphere for supporters and offers visiting fans stunning views of the surrounding landscape. The team traditionally plays in blue and navy striped shirts, a color scheme that has remained largely unchanged throughout their history.

Recent Developments

In 2019, Como 1907 entered an exciting new chapter when it was acquired by SENT Entertainment Ltd, led by Indonesian brothers Michael and Hartono Djarum. This takeover brought renewed financial stability and ambition to the club. Under this ownership, Como has embarked on a project to return to Italian football’s upper echelons, making strategic investments in both infrastructure and playing staff.

Current Status and Achievements

As of the 2023-24 season, Como competes in Serie B, Italy’s second tier, where they have shown significant improvement. The team has assembled a competitive squad, mixing experienced players with promising young talent. While major trophies have eluded the club, Como has won several lower division titles throughout its history and has produced notable players who have gone on to achieve success with bigger clubs and the national team.
